Chronic carcinogenesis studies of acrolein and related compounds.
Toxicol. Ind. Health 3(3) , 337-45, (1987)
Acrolein and two of its more stable derivatives, the oxime and the diethylacetal, and the related allyl alcohol were given in drinking water to groups of 20 male and 20 female F344 rats at doses close...
